Global policy

Our Global Policy work promotes policy alignment, clarity and effectiveness across jurisdictions; through research and analysis on foundational financial and real economy policy reforms; in support of the PRI’s mission, its six principles, and our signatory policy expertise and engagement activities.

To this end, the PRI also engages with multilateral organisations, UN agencies and host governments of key international forums to support ambitious policy reforms on sustainable finance and real-economy policies in alignment with global sustainability goals.

The PRI has responded to a consultation on the organisation of the Veredas Dialogue on Art. 2.1(c) of the Paris Agreement.

PRI calls on regulators to support IASB guidance for better reflecting climate in financial statements

2025-12-16T15:45:00+00:00

Global: The PRI has written to the European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A), the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C), the Canadian Securities Administrators (CSA), and the Financial Reporting Council (FRC) urging them to strengthen climate-related financial reporting.

A Legal Framework for Impact

It is crucial that assessing and accounting for sustainability impact becomes a core part of investment activity. That’s why PRI, UNEP FI and The Generation Foundation are leading our work programme “A Legal Framework for Impact.”
